Canon EF 24-70 f/4L IS Lens “On the Horizon”

October 31, 2012 By Eric Reagan

Canon 24-70mm f4 IS Rumors

After the rumor about a 24-70mm f/2.8L IS lens from Canon a couple days ago, Canon Rumors is now tweaking that rumor with “reliable” info on a f/4 version of that lens.  Apparently, the f/4 version of the lens is on the horizon and could be arriving soon.

Seems like an odd lens to add to the mix, particularly with the solid 24-105mm f/4L IS that’s been selling like hotcakes since its release.  Of course, if the sharpness improvements are as substantial as the 24-70mm f/2.8L II were over the lens it replaced, a smaller and lighter lens might serve as a replacement and more directly compliment the popular 70-200mm lineup.

Perfect Photo Suite 7 Now Available

October 31, 2012 By Eric Reagan

Perfect Photo Suite 7

onOne Software’s Perfect Photo Suite 7 is now available and features five new products—Perfect B&W, Perfect Portrait 2, Perfect Layers 3, Perfect Effects 4 and Perfect Resize 7.5 Pro­, integrated with existing products Perfect Mask 5.2 and FocalPoint 2.

Perfect Photo Suite 7 is available at www.ononesoftware.com. New users can purchase Perfect Photo Suite 7 for $299.95. Owners of Perfect Photo Suite 6, Perfect Photo Suite 5.5, and Plug-In Suite 5 or earlier can upgrade to Perfect Photo Suite 7 for $149.95. New purchases and upgrades made by November 15, 2012 will also receive the Premium Preset Pak1 for free, which includes 20 presets designed especially for Perfect B&W, Perfect Portrait 2 and Perfect Effects 4.

Nikon D5200 Coming Soon

October 31, 2012 By Eric Reagan

Rumors are heating up for yet another DSLR reveal from Nikon before 2012 is over.  Nikon Rumors points to the aging D5100 set for replacement by a D5200 that will sport a 24MP sensor.

Nikon D5200 Rumored Specs

  • 24MP DX-format CMOS sensor
  • EXPEED 3 image processor (same was Nikon D3200)
  • ISO 100-6400 (expandable to ISO 25,600)
  • 2,016 RGB metering sensor
  • 5 fps continuous shooting speed
  • 3-inch vari-angle LCD at 921k-dot resolution

According to the rumors, the Nikon D5200 should hit within the next month or so.  Stay tuned for the latest.

Red Giant and CrumplePop Announce Retrograde and Carousel Plug-ins for FCP X

October 30, 2012 By Eric Reagan

Red Giant Carousel

Red Giant and CrumplePop have partnered together for a pair of new grading and color effect plug-ins for Final Cut Pro X.

Retrograde offers the ability create the color, grain, and damage of old 8mm and 16mm films by dragging effects from the Effects bin in FCP X. It includes 5 types of 8mm film stock and 5 types of 16mm film stock.  Once applied, you can tweak the settings and customize the look to fit your taste. [Read more…]

Nikon ViewNX 2.6.0 and Capture NX 2.3.5 Now Available

October 30, 2012 By Eric Reagan

Nikon 1 V2

Nikon has released updates for View NX 2 and Capture NX 2.

Nikon ViewNX 2.6.0 update adds the following improvement:

  • Focus points are now displayed in images captured with a Nikon 1 camera.

Nikon Capture NX 2.3.5 adds the following improvements:

  • Support for RAW images captured with the Nikon 1 V2 has been added.
  • Support for Mac OS X version 10.8 has been added.

Canon 5D Mark III Gets Another Price Drop – Down to $2,994

October 29, 2012 By Eric Reagan

Canon 5D Mark III

The Canon 5D Mark III dropped to $3199 last week, which was the cheapest we’ve seen it thus far.  Now, the 5D Mark III is down to $2994 at B&H Photo, which puts it even with its chief rival, the Nikon D800.

Also, the 5D Mark III w/ 24-105mm f/4L IS kit lens is down to $3749.
